ADVERTISEMENT FOR A/E RE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S

line.GIF (550 bytes)

Pursuant to the Alabama Act No. 2001-956, the Alabama Supercomputer Authority seeks an Architectural and/or Engineering firm to provide professional services that include design, project manual, construction contract procurement, and construction administration for remodeling of the entrance foyer and lobby of the Alabama Supercomputer Center. 

Description:  The majority of the work will include redesign, remodeling and renovation of the entrance foyer, lobby and restrooms on the first floor of the George C. Wallace Alabama Supercomputer Center at 686 Discovery Drive in Huntsville, Alabama.  There will also be minor renovations to the main conference room and the hallways.  The project budget is $250,000.00. 

Qualifications:  The Alabama Supercomputer Authority will select the most qualified design professional as outlined in the Manual of Procedures, 2001 Edition, prepared by the Alabama Building Commission.  Applicants will be selected on the basis of professional qualifications and successful experience with similar architectural and/or engineering service engagements.  Applicants seeking to provide services for the project must demonstrate prior experience with design for supercomputing facilities.  Only those firms and/or teams with experience designing these types of systems will be considered.  Applicants must be professional engineers registered with the Alabama State Board of Registration for Professional Engineers and Land Surveyors. 

Recognizing the composition of Alabama’s citizenship, the Alabama Supercomputer Authority encourages proposasl from design professionals that represent Alabama firms with diversity in their staffing, proposed project team and associated design professionals and consultants. 

All applicable State of Alabama Building Commission documents and procedures shall be utilized on this project.

Act 2001-955 requires a disclosure statement to be completed and filed with all proposals, bids, contracts, or grant proposals submitted to the State of Alabama in excess of $5,000.   The form is also available online here.

Act 2011-535 (Alabama Immigration Law) imposes conditions on the award of State contracts.  Those requirements are effective 1 January 2012 for contracts receiving State funds.  Architects and Engineers should review and adhere to these guidelines as appropriate to their project type.  For additional information on this subject please refer to the Alabama Building Commission bulletins

Interested firms must submit qualifications on GSA Standard Form 330, along with any other relevant information.
